Travel TV show features Columbia in upcoming episode

Columbia viewers who tune into ETV’s South Carolina Channel on Saturday night will see some familiar sights.

TV host Darley Newman explores the city with locals as her guides in “Travels with Darley,” airing at 5 p.m. Saturday.

In the episode, Newman, who grew up in Myrtle Beach, spends the morning in Five Points sipping a latte at Drip, followed by shopping at 2G’s Clothing and lunch at The Gourmet Shop. There’s also a visit to the Woodrow Wilson House & Gardens, Sweet Cream Company on Main Street, One Eared Cow Glass in the Vista and Southern Belly BBQ on Rosewood Drive.

The show filmed the episode in August, said Five Points Association Executive Director Amy Beth Franks, who led Newman on a tour through Five Points.

“It was really great because they were able to capture the vibrancy of Five Points so easily,” Franks said. “It was this great representation of the city and will be a wonderful episode.”

The show came to Columbia due to a partnership with the Midlands Authority on Conventions, Sports and Tourism. The episode also includes locations in Maryland and Virginia, according to Andrea Mensink, director of communications for Midlands Authority.

If you miss “Travels With Darley” Saturday, you can catch it at 7 p.m. Feb. 26 on ETV.
